Introduction
Sascha Julian Oks graduated from University of Bayreuth and Stellenbosch University, South Africa, with a Master of Science in business administration. His research and teaching focuses on the effects of the digital transformation on industrial value creation with an emphasis on industrial cyber-physical systems. In several design-oriented studies he has built web-tools and the Industry 4.0 demonstrator “PID4CPS” to support organizations in the implementation of their digitization strategies.
